    Our go to for bubble teas - located across the street from the high schools on the same side as Classic Cafe. This wasn't around when I went to Classical, which now that I think about it is prob dating me (I'm old!) but whatever! Have been there several times now and can't complain. My favorite so far is the Fireworks Smoothie (Acai, Lychee and Mango). Just enough mix of tart and sweet for my taste. The bobas have a good texture, I have found others to be undercooked - but these had a good chew to them. There are only a few options that are made with real fruit (jackfruit and durian, although I was told the jackfruit is canned) and everything else is powder. That's the only ding I could give - I would prefer fresh fruit but I'm sure it's a lot pricier to maintain. We happened to be in the area around 9:50PM on a Saturday night and were surprised to see they were still open - looks like they're open 'til 10PM Fridays and Saturdays now! There is only street parking but we haven't had an issue finding parking yet. The staff is young but very friendly and your drinks are made fairly quickly. They do have a loyalty card as well - after 5 drinks, your 6th is free!
